shama sikander wiki : Shama Sikander Gesawat (born 4 August 1981) is an Indian actress who is best remembered for her lead role in the TV series Yeh Meri Life Hai (2003-2005). She has acted in television serials and is also known as a TV program host and a reality show contestant. On the big screen, she has appeared in a few Bollywood movies, including the Aamir Khan starrer Mann in 1999.

Sikander is also active as a fashion model, and she launched her own design company, Saisha, in 2010.

Shama Sikander Gesawat was born in Makrana, Rajasthan, India, and is the daughter of Gulshan, a housewife and Sikander Gesawat who was a marble supplier and now practices ayurveda. At the age of 10 her family moved to Mumbai, Maharashtra, where she lived together with her younger siblings, Khalid, Rizwan Sikander, and Salma (born 1991). Sikander has mentioned in interviews that her early years in Mumbai were extremely difficult, even commenting that at times "there was no food in the house to feed the family".

Having moved locations frequently,Sikander attended as many as nine schools in her early life in Makrana and in various parts of Greater Mumbai including Malad, Mumbra, Thane, and Andheri. Following her completion of the 10th grade, and passing the Indian Certificate of Secondary Education examination, Sikander enrolled in the Roshan Taneja School of Acting in Mumbai in 1995, graduating from the course a year later.

Sikander began her career on the big screen with small parts in Prem Aggan (1998, Hindi) and Mann (1999, Hindi) before landing a supporting role in Ansh: The Deadly Part (2002, Hindi). She first gained significant recognition on television as the title character "Pooja Mehta" in the popular Sony TV drama Ye Meri Life Hai (2003-2005). The performance earned her numerous nominations and awards, her wins including the 12th Annual Lion's Gold Awards' Critics' Choice "Best Actress" (2005), Sony TV's "Best Face" (2005), Indian Television Academy Awards' "GR8! Face of the Year" (2004), and "Best Debut" (2004). Sikander subsequently anchored Popkorn Newz (2007) and Jet Set Go (2008) before returning to film with lead role of "Jiya" in Dhoom Dhadaka (2008). She subsequently appeared in the lead role of "Shunyaa" on the supernatural thriller TV series Seven (2010-2011 Hindi) produced by Bollywood juggernaut Yash Raj Films. She was seen as "Byankar Pari", the lead antagonist in the children's program Baal Veer (2012–2014) on SAB TV, but quit for her company.

Sikander's production company Chocolate Box Films Pvt. Ltd., founded in late 2012, has yet to announce its first production.

In 2010 Indian gossip columnist Vicky Lalwani linked Sikander to actor Mimoh Chakraborty – a claim both parties denied.

In mid-2011 speculation began regarding Sikander's relationship with India-based American actor / musician Alexx O'Nell The two were spotted with increasing frequency throughout 2011 and Sikander confirmed that they were indeed in a relationship in an interview which featured on the cover of Showtime Magazine's December 2011 issue, entitled "Shama Sikander Finally Breaks Her Silence on Her Relationship With Alexx O'Nell". Later, a June 2012 interview with Sikander disclosed that the two met through friends at a sundown party .. and that she was "won over nearly immediately after he played some music for her ... [O'Nell's original] compositions ... to be featured in an album that will release soon." Sikander and O'Nell's relationship was confirmed to be over in January 2015.

In January 2016, it was confirmed that Sikander got engaged to American businessman James Milliron in Dubai, UAE.
